Colour: pale yellow, greenish.
Aroma: beautifully pure, floral nose.
Tasting notes: a racy, energetic feel with nuances of stone fruit, acacia, brioche and underlying minerality. Lovely purity and vitality run like a vein through the wine, which has a long, crisp, slightly nutty finish.
Serving suggestions: as aperitif or with artichoke and gruyère dip.
